Position Information

EXAMINATION SCHEDULE:

  • Written Exam: will be conducted on December 4, 2025
Examinations: Written Exam (Weight 100%): May include knowledge of basic math, public relations, basic case management principles, field safety and other relevant subjects.

Applicants must attain at least a 70% score on each phase of the examination process.

Full Job Description: Behavioral Health Recovery Specialist Aide

Minimum Qualifications/Employment Standards: Nine (9) months of full time paid experience working in a social service or mental health setting in a capacity requiring interaction with the chronically mentally ill OR completion of thirty (30) semester or forty-five (45) quarter units from an accredited college or university with course work in behavioral sciences.

Volunteer experience may be qualifying if confirmed in writing from a recognized organization.

Dependent upon assignment, applicants may be required to pass an extensive background investigation, and be fingerprinted. Disqualification for felony, misdemeanor, and traffic offenses will be assessed on a case-by-case basis.

A valid California Class "C" Driver's License is required at the time of appointment.

Kern County Employee Benefits

  • As a regular or provisional employee of Kern County, working twenty (20) hours or more per week, you are presently eligible for the following benefits as described below:

Health Insurance: (Medical/Dental/Vision): Kern County offers five affordable medical options. Kern Legacy Health Plans are medical and prescription health plan options administered directly by the County of Kern. Kaiser Permanente is also an option. Employees may also choose from two dental plans; Liberty Dental PPO or HMO. The vision coverage is provided through Vision Service Plan (VSP).

Retirement Program: Kern County Employees' Retirement Association (KCERA). This Section 401 (a) defined benefit retirement plan requires employer and employee contribution and pays retired employees a pension based on salary, years of service, and age upon retirement.

Deferred Compensation: This section 457 plan allows employees to contribute on a pre-tax basis to a supplemental retirement account which is then paid out to them when they retire.

Social Security Administration:
Note: Both Kern County and the employee contribute to Social Security and Medicare as follows:
  • The County of Kern withholds 6.2% for Social Security (FICA1) and 1.45% for Medicare (FICA2) from employee's payroll warrants
  • The County matches the employee's 6.2% for Social Security and 1.45% for Medicare
Employee Assistance Program: EAP is available to help you take control of your life!

Voluntary Benefits: Chimienti & Associates (Administrator) offers the following voluntary benefits and can be deducted on a pre-tax bases: Short Term Disability Coverage, Accident Plan, Cancer Plan and a Flexible Spending Account.

Paid Holiday Leave: 12 set days (per calendar year)
